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Redskins; or The Littlepage Manuscripts is a novel by the American novelist James Fenimore Cooper first published in 1845. The Redskins is the third book in a trilogy starting with Satanstoe and continuing with The Chainbearer and ending with The Redskins. The novel focuses mainly on issues of land ownership and the displacement of American Indians as the United States moves Westward.

Book excerpt: Early in the 1840s, Hugh Roger Littlepage, a bachelor of fifty-nine commonly called Ro (the second son of Mordaunt and Ursula Malbone Littlepage), and his nephew Hugh Roger Littlepage, twenty-five (son of the deceased first son, Malbone, of Mordaunt and Ursula Littlepage), resettled in Paris after extended travels in the Mideast, discuss at length the changing customs of their home country, the United States, and admit to a twinge of homesickness. Numerous letters and newspapers awaiting them following their eighteen-month absence from Paris acquaint the two men with the increased fervor of the anti-rent movement in New York State, a movement that threatens the security of their own property holdings. Every aspect of current life at home is reviewed during the ensuing discussion -- political, social, economic, philosophical, and sentimental -- and thus the background is provided for the action that later takes place in the novel. Most of the significant characters of the entire novel are introduced in the course of the two-day discussion, interrupted only by the hours spent in sleep, and prompted by the tidings found either in family or business letters or in the accumulated newspapers from home.

Book excerpt: About the Author- James Fenimore Cooper (September 15, 1789 - September 14, 1851) was a prolific and popular American writer of the early 19th century. His historical romances of frontier and Indian life in the early American days created a unique form of American literature. He lived most of his life in Cooperstown, New York, which was established by his father William. Cooper was a lifelong member of the Episcopal Church and in his later years contributed generously to it He attended Yale University for three years, where he was a member of the Linonian Society, but was expelled for misbehavior. Before embarking on his career as a writer he served in the U.S. Navy as a Midshipman which greatly influenced many of his novels and other writings. He is best remembered as a novelist who wrote numerous sea-stories and the historical novels known as the Leatherstocking Tales. Among naval historians Cooper's works on the early U.S. Navy have been well received, but they were sometimes criticized by his contemporaries. Book excerpt: In The Redskins we have the third and last work of the anti-rent series, in which the crisis is reached, and the cupidity and lawless spirit of the disorderly faction appear in their true light. "You well know that I am no advocate for any government but that which is founded on popular right, protected from popular abuses, " -- were words which Mr. Fenimore Cooper had written many years earlier. And now, in the hour of danger, to aid in protecting these rights of the people, against their abuse by the evil-minded among themselves, he held to be a high duty of every honest, and generous, and intelligent citizen. "As democrats, we protest most solemnly against such barefaced frauds, such palpable cupidity and covetousness being termed any thing but what they are. Democracy is a lofty and noble sentiment. It is just, and treats all men alike. It is not the friend of a canting legislation, but meaning right, dare act directly. There is no greater delusion than to suppose that true democracy has any thing in common with injustice or roguery. Nor is it any apology to anti-rentism, in any of its aspects, to say that leasehold tenures are inexpedient. The most expedient thing in existence is to do right.
